The Ammonium nitrate is a white crystalline salt with the chemical formula NH₄NO₃, widely used around the world as a high‑value nitrogen fertilizer and as an industrial oxidizing agent. As a fertilizer, it supplies both ammonium and nitrate forms of nitrogen — nutrients that are immediately available to plants and support rapid vegetative growth, high yields, and efficient nitrogen uptake. Its relatively high nitrogen content and good solubility make ammonium nitrate popular for cereals, vegetables, and many cash crops, and it is commonly supplied as prills, granules, or in solution for foliar and fertigation systems.

Beyond agriculture, ammonium nitrate has legitimate industrial applications as an oxidizer in mining, quarrying, and construction, where it is incorporated into formulated blasting agents under strict regulatory and safety controls. Its energetic chemistry means that handling, storage, and transport are tightly regulated in most jurisdictions to prevent accidental detonation, decomposition, or misuse. Because of its dual‑use nature, manufacturers, distributors, and end users must comply with licensing, secure storage, recordkeeping, and transport requirements imposed by local and national authorities.

Safety and risk management are central whenever ammonium nitrate is used. The compound itself is stable under normal conditions, but it can become hazardous if contaminated with organic materials, chlorates, or combustible substances, or if stored under prolonged high temperature or confinement. Personal protective equipment and training for handlers reduce occupational exposure risks such as dust inhalation and skin contact.

Environmental considerations are also important. Excessive or improper application of ammonium nitrate can lead to nitrate leaching into groundwater and contribute to eutrophication of surface waters. Precision application techniques, soil testing, split applications, and integrated nutrient management help minimize nitrogen losses while maintaining crop productivity. Agricultural stewardship programs and enhanced-efficiency formulations are increasingly used to balance agronomic performance with environmental protection.

Manufacture of ammonium nitrate typically involves neutralizing nitric acid with ammonia and then concentrating and prilling or granulating the resulting solution; modern production facilities emphasize quality control, purity, and the removal of impurities that could affect performance or safety. Product variants — including coated or stabilized grades — address specific handling, dusting, and caking concerns and can be tailored for direct soil application, blending with other fertilizers, or use in liquid feeding systems.

Overall, ammonium nitrate remains a cornerstone material for modern agriculture and several industrial sectors because of its high nitrogen content and functional versatility. Its benefits come with clear responsibilities: correct agronomic practice, rigorous safety management, regulatory compliance, and environmental stewardship are essential to maximize its value while minimizing risks.
